Alleged mob justice incident in Dwarsloop

The victim died at Mapulaneng Hospital after being fatally assaulted by a mob that allegedly wrongly accused him of local crimes without any evidence.

A 30-year-old man was allegedly killed by community members in an act of mob justice in Dwarsloop Phase One, near Bushbuckridge, on March 23.

Mpumalanga police spokesperson, Captain Mpho Nonyane-Mpe, stated that preliminary investigations revealed the victim had been accused by community members of committing various crimes.

“It was revealed that there were reports of a rape in the area and several housebreakings. The community concluded on their own, without any proof, that the deceased was the suspect. It is further alleged that residents gathered, confronted, and assaulted the man in the street, leaving him seriously injured. However, when he was confronted, nothing [incriminating] was found on him,” Nonyane-Mpe said.

She added that an ambulance was called following the assault. The victim was transported to Mapulaneng Hospital, where he later succumbed to his injuries.

No arrests have been made at this stage, and investigations are ongoing.

“The police strongly condemn acts of vigilantism and urge community members to refrain from taking the law into their own hands. Such actions undermine the rule of law and may result in further criminal charges,” Nonyane-Mpe said.
